Intel 12th Gen Core ‘Alder Lake’ structure and specs

The 14nm node saga, which has stretched on because the introduction of the Broadwell (5th Gen Core) die shrink in 2014, is lastly over and accomplished with, at the very least so far as Intel’s desktop CPUs go. The 11th Gen ‘Rocket Lake’ household was a 10nm design backported to 14nm as a way to get it into clients’ palms amid ongoing 10nm manufacturing constraints, and now hopefully these have been solved for good.

Intel calls its present 10nm course of implementation ‘Intel 7′, which is a fairly blunt try and place it as technologically on par with rivals’ mature 7nm efforts. At this scale, the sizes of particular person transistors aren’t essentially mirrored by such names, and with a transfer to modular tile-based CPU designs, they do not all must be the identical measurement anyway. However, ‘Intel 7′ tells us that the corporate has renewed confidence in its personal fabs and foundries, at the same time as we see information that the next-generation node can even be delayed.

The larger information is that Intel has now separated its structure and manufacturing efforts to the purpose that it might probably combine and match completely different bits of a CPU’s parts corresponding to cores, the built-in GPU, cache reminiscence, IO logic, safety subsystems, and extra. Totally different implementations of ‘Alder Lake’ for various goal markets, ie desktop PCs, laptops, and ultra-mobile units, can have completely different combos of those parts.

For now, we have now the top-of-the-line Core i9-12900K desktop CPU with eight “Efficiency” cores (with their very own codename, ‘Golden Cove’) and eight “Environment friendly” cores (‘Gracemont’). The P-cores, in Intel’s shorthand, are what we’re accustomed to – Golden Cove is the successor to ‘Willow Cove’ which all 11th Gen 10nm CPUs have been primarily based on. Gracemont is the present spinoff of the previous Intel Atom CPU lineup – though the Atom title has been retired, ‘-mont’ cores have been the idea of a lot of Intel’s embedded CPU choices in addition to low-end Pentium Silver and Celeron CPUs through the years. Most lately, Intel’s first hybrid providing, ‘Lakefield’, additionally mixed previous-gen ‘-cove’ and ‘-mont’ cores.

That is plenty of codenames, and Intel is studiously avoiding the time period ‘huge.LITTLE’ which is rival Arm’s trademark, and goes again at the very least a decade. This after all refers to precisely the identical idea – dividing work between a bunch of high-performance however power-hungry cores in addition to low-power cores primarily based on that are extra appropriate, as a way to maximise energy in addition to effectivity. Intel itself had rejected the concept of doing so on a number of events prior to now, saying that it is potential to design one sort of core that may scale adequately by way of energy consumption in addition to efficiency. Clearly, although, the corporate has modified its thoughts.

To ensure that an working system to know which cores to focus on and when emigrate threads from one sort of core to a different, Intel says it has developed a extra strong and responsive real-time scheduler, referred to as Thread Director. As of now, this works solely with Home windows 11, and neither Intel nor Microsoft have plans to convey it to Home windows 10. An answer for Linux is presently in growth. In keeping with Intel, it’s best to anticipate a slight efficiency drop with Home windows 10, however Alder Lake CPUs will nonetheless be completely usable.

intel alderlake launch

One enormous change with Alder Lake hybrid CPUs is that solely the P-cores help Hyper-Threading, which is the power to run a second simultaneous thread when sources enable for it. Due to this fact, the 16-core Core i9-12900K is able to executing 24 threads, not 32. Apparently, whereas the the P-cores get prime precedence, the E-cores come subsequent, and provided that they’re saturated will a P-core be assigned a second thread. Home windows 11 can leverage Thread Director to resolve what will get precedence the place – for instance you would be encoding media within the background whereas getting on with different duties.

It would not appear as if customers will be capable to override this and manually specify whether or not any specific program or activity must be given desire for every core sort. It is going to be fascinating to see how upcoming 12th Gen laptop computer CPUs add battery life to the listing of variables which might be being juggled by Home windows 11. What’s additionally odd is that Intel says closely multi-threaded workflows corresponding to video encoding will desire E-cores, although standard logic means that P-cores ought to be capable to muscle by means of such duties faster.

There’s another difficulty at play right here – some older software program would not recognise the heterogenous cores as all belonging to the identical CPU. You may encounter some compatibility points – the Denuvo recreation DRM scheme has lately been flagged as incompatible, locking folks out of at the very least 50 older video games as a result of it thinks system specs have modified because of piracy. In such circumstances, you’ll be able to lock the E-cores out fully by means of your motherboard BIOS (and Intel says you’ll be able to even assign the Scroll Lock key in your keyboard to toggle this).

Intel has additionally maintained that the AVX-512 instruction set, a function closely touted since Ice Lake for its use in accelerating AI workloads, has been disabled. This was purportedly as a result of solely the P-cores can help it and there must be instruction parity between core sorts. Nonetheless, it now appears that disabling E-cores in your motherboard BIOS will enable AVX-512 to be enabled – so there is a tradeoff there too.

Whereas every P-core has 1.25MB of L2 cache reminiscence, the E-cores are organized in clusters of 4, every with a shared 2MB L2 cache. These feed into a standard L3 cache. Intel additionally publishes completely different base and turbo speeds for every core sort, and higher-tier CPU fashions moreover help Intel’s Turbo Increase Max function that assigns “favoured cores” which may be boosted even increased. Meaning clock velocity is now extraordinarily muddled and never essentially a helpful metric relating to evaluating specs. We’ve got a 125W base TDP, and for the primary time Intel can be publishing energy goal figures for sustained load, which may go as much as 241W for the Core i9. You probably have a succesful sufficient thermal answer, you can run at Turbo speeds indefinitely – not simply in bursts.

On the Core i9-12900K, the eight E-cores run between 2.4GHz and three.9GHz, whereas the eight P-cores run between 3.2GHz and 5.1GHz (all cores) or 5.2GHz (favoured cores). There’s 14MB of L2 cache and 30MB of L3 cache reminiscence.

The Core i7-12700K loses 4 E-cores so that you get eight P-cores and 4 E-cores (totalling 20 threads). Peak energy utilization is rated at 190W. The Core i5-12600K has six P-cores and 4 E-cores, with a 150W peak energy draw score.

All three CPU fashions function built-in Intel UHD Graphics 770 built-in GPUs, primarily based on the Xe-LP structure. Nothing is new in comparison with the 11th Gen’s built-in UHD 750 GPU, apart from decrease base and better enhance clocks. All three CPUs even have -F suffix variants which lack built-in graphics and are priced just a little decrease on paper.

Intel 12th Gen Core ‘Alder Lake’ Z690 platform

Contemplating how a lot has modified with Alder Lake, it is no shock {that a} new socket and new motherboards will probably be required. These CPUs are bodily bigger than most earlier mainstream Intel desktop CPUs, and are actually rectangular quite than sq.. The pad depend has jumped to 1700 (from 1200) and so there is a new LGA1700 socket. Hopefully, this could final for at the very least another era. Most coolers designed for previous-gen motherboards ought to work, however you’ll almost certainly want a retrofit package – most manufacturers will replace their choices or supply a easy adapter package. It could be finest to test along with your cooler’s producer, since there might be uncommon exceptions because of variations within the contact floor space.

The largest information for many customers would be the introduction of DDR5 RAM. This guarantees vital jumps in bandwidth, most capability, and energy effectivity. DDR4 has been entrenched for a really very long time but in addition is not prone to disappear anytime quickly – DDR5 RAM kits are presently laborious to search out and fairly costly, particularly in India. You can purchase Z690 motherboards with both DDR4 or DDR5 slots (dual-channel in both case) – no producer has proven off a hybrid board but. Meaning you will must commit to at least one commonplace or the opposite upfront.

Intel has additionally managed to be the primary to introduce PCIe 5.0, which doubles inside IO bandwidth in comparison with PCIe 4.0. There are no parts corresponding to SSDs that may benefit from this but, however at the very least you get to share that bandwidth between units so extra can function at excessive velocity. Motherboards can have one PCIe 5.0 x16 slot or route that bandwidth to 2 PCIe 5.0 x8 slots, and these join on to the CPU. That is along with 4 PCIe 4.0 lanes that may now be devoted to an SSD, plus the Z690 controller itself hosts 12 PCIe 4.0 lanes and one other 16 PCIe 3.0 lanes for varied parts. Bandwidth between the CPU and the Z690 has doubled as effectively.

Additionally on the connectivity entrance, there’s now help for as much as 4 USB 3.2 Gen2x2 (20Gbps) – this should not be confused with USB4 Gen3 which may additionally obtain 20Gbps with the identical Sort-C connector. You’ll be able to have as much as 10 USB 3.2 Gen2 (10Gbps) ports as effectively, between the rear panel and extra headers. PCIe and M.2 slot configurations will rely on motherboard producers. Intel has applied a Wi-Fi 6E controller, which is a step up from Wi-Fi 6, and there is nonetheless built-in Gigabit Ethernet. After all issues like Intel Optane are supported, and all Z-series motherboards are overclocking-friendly.

Decrease-end platforms will probably be launched when Intel launches non-Okay 12th Gen CPUs, and we do not but understand how they are going to be differentiated and whether or not sure options will probably be unique to the top-tier Z690. Clearly with the break up between DDR4 and DDR5, there will probably be an enormous number of Z690 motherboards to select from. Asus, Gigabyte, MSI, ASRock, and a few smaller manufacturers have already launched a range within the Indian market.

Asus TUF Gaming Z690-Plus WiFi D4 motherboard and Strix LC II 360 ARGB AIO cooler

For this evaluation, Asus despatched throughout one among its extra reasonably priced Z690 motherboards, the TUF Gaming Z690-Plus WiFi D4, in addition to a Strix LC II 360 ARGB AIO cooler with an LGA1700 adapter. The D4 suffix signifies that this board will solely work with DDR4 RAM, which is becoming given the phase it targets. Whereas not fairly as tricked-out as flagship fashions that promote for as a lot as Rs. 65,000, this motherboard ought to be capable to deal with most of what fans want, at a much more approachable value of Rs. 25,000.

The board structure has no huge surprises. It has 4 slots for a most of 128GB of RAM with overclocking help going as much as DDR4-5333. There are chunky VRM heatsinks across the CPU socket, which could intervene with extraordinarily giant air coolers, and you will wish to watch out of some sharp corners.

I did notice an absence of little conveniences like an LED diagnostic show and surface-mount energy and reset buttons, which make preliminary meeting and dealing on an open bench simpler. You additionally do not get a secondary BIOS as a failsafe. On the plus aspect, Asus has developed an M.2 latch system that dispenses with the same old tiny screws, and also you get heatsinks on all 4 M.2 slots.

The built-in rear IO defend is way appreciated and can make set up simpler. There’s one USB 3.2 Gen2x2 (20Gbps) Sort-C port, two USB 3.2 Gen2 (10Gbps) Sort-A ports, and 5 USB 3.2 Gen1 (5Gbps) ports, one among which is Sort-C and 4 Sort-A. This board additionally has HDMI 2.1 and DisplayPort 1.4 video outputs, 2.5Gbps Ethernet, two terminals for the included Wi-Fi 6 antenna, optical S/PDIF audio output, and the usual 5 analogue 3.5mm audio jacks. Sadly you aren’t getting Thunderbolt at this value level, or exterior BIOS reset and replace buttons. Bluetooth 5.2 is an invisible bonus.

asus tuf z690 d4 rear ndtv intel

The rear IO panel of the TUF Gaming Z690-Plus Wifi D4 affords plenty of connectivity

 

Inner headers will enable for as much as 4 USB 2.0 ports plus high-speed entrance panel Sort-A and Sort-C ports. There are a number of ARGB management headers and 4 chassis fan connection factors along with impartial CPU fan and AIO pump headers. You do get RGB lighting however the tiny accents on one fringe of the board and underneath the Z690 heatsink are literally fairly straightforward to overlook. There are solely 4 SATA ports; two going through upwards and two going through sideways off the board’s edge.

There are 4 M.2 slots, all however one among which have heatsinks. The first slot is fed by the CPU immediately. Just one slot can work with an M.2 SATA SSD; the opposite three together with the first one are NVMe-only. The primary PCIe slot can be wired to the CPU, and will get a full 16 lanes of PCIe 5.0 bandwidth. The second x16 slot in addition to the one x4 and two x1 slots may need to share bandwidth with the M.2 slots relying on which of them you populate. 

The UEFI BIOS is sort of straightforward to navigate. You’ll be able to see an outline in “straightforward mode” or dig deep into the menus, the place you will discover an array of choices for controlling onboard options and appreciable guide overclocking controls. General, the Asus TUF Gaming Z690-Plus WiFi D4 does lack some conveniences, however delivers lots contemplating its value. In the event you aren’t an avid overclocker with an elaborate liquid cooling setup, and are planning to stay with DDR4 RAM, this might be a stable base to construct upon.

Asus says that the Strix LC II 360 ARGB cooler (priced at Rs. 18,950 in India) will work with LGA1700 processors simply superb as they’re. Even so, new models will ship with a redesigned bracket, so that you may wish to be sure that of this in case you’re shopping for a brand new one. The whole lot comes neatly packaged within the field, and it is easy to place the components collectively. The instruction leaflet would not cowl issues like push/pull orientation for the followers, or which manner the radiator must be oriented relying on the place you wish to place it in your cupboard. Asus additionally might have used resealable baggage with clearer labels for all of the brackets, screws, and washers since a number of are included for each AMD and Intel mounts. On the intense aspect, there isn’t any separate controller unit for fan or RGB management and the wiring to your motherboard headers is easy.

Intel Core i9-12900K and Core i5-12600K efficiency

Each CPUs have been examined with the identical set of parts, beginning with the Asus TUF Gaming Z690-Plus WiFi D4 motherboard and Strix LC II 360 ARGB AIO cooler. The remainder of the rig was comprised of a 2x16GB Corsair Dominator Platinum RGB DDR4-3600 RAM package, a Sapphire Nitro+ Radeon RX 590 graphics card (eliminated when testing the CPUs’ built-in GPUs), a 2TB Kingston KC3000 PCIe 4.0 NVMe SSD and a 1TB Samsung SSD 860 EVO SSD, a Corsair RM850 energy provide, and an Asus PB287Q 4K monitor.

All checks have been run utilizing a contemporary set up of Home windows 11, with all obtainable patches put in and all drivers up to date. This, plus the usage of DDR4 RAM, and the truth that not all checks is likely to be up to date to recognise and exploit heterogenous cores, may mirror in some benchmark outcomes. We’ve got the previous-gen Core i9-11900K and Core i5-11600K to check check outcomes with, in addition to some previous-gen and HEDT Intel and AMD CPUs (lockdown-related restrictions imply we do not have Ryzen 5000 collection scores to check in opposition to but). The factor that jumps out initially is how a lot of a bounce there may be in checks that may scale to any variety of cores and threads. Whereas the earlier era Core i9 flagship topped out at 8 cores and 16 threads, there’s clearly lots to be gained simply by having these counts go as much as 16 and 24 respectively, no matter structure. We see vital scaling in 3D rendering and ray tracing benchmarks, and though the Home windows 11 Process Supervisor would not distinguish between core sorts, it did present all 24 threads on the Core i9-12900K absolutely saturated throughout such checks.

Single-threaded efficiency additionally advantages tremendously, which suggests video games will get a pleasant enhance in case you aren’t bottlenecked by your GPU. The Core i5-12600K strikes an fascinating stability right here – a number of cores, plus the architectural benefits that profit lightly-threaded duties. It is costly, by mid-range CPU requirements, however might even be an improve over Core i7 and Core i9 fashions from the previous few generations. This mannequin is prone to be a success with players.

One factor that does must be famous is energy consumption. Intel’s TDP score system has modified to acknowledge that energy draw is way increased than the rated stage underneath stress, and now a CPU can run at turbo velocity nearly unrestricted so long as your cooling answer is ample. In the event you stress these CPUs for prolonged durations, you will be pulling plenty of energy out of your PSU (but in addition getting lots accomplished).

Computerized overclocking with the Asus TUF Gaming Z690-Plus Wifi D4 motherboard is as straightforward as deciding on a number of choices within the BIOS and letting the system check its personal limits. You possibly can additionally use Intel’s Excessive Tuning Utility or Asus’ AI Suite 3 utilities by means of Home windows. I used to be in a position to push the Core i9-12900K as much as 5.3GHz on the P-cores and 4GHz on the E-cores in underneath a minute. The system ran completely secure and benchmarks ran superb, although the Strix cooler did run noticeably louder and ramp as much as full velocity a lot faster.

After this minor overclock, CineBench R20’s single-core rating rose from 760 to 791, and the multi-core rating from 10,324 to 10,795. POVRay’s render time was minimize from 29 seconds to 27 seconds, and the Corona rendering benchmark ran in 57 seconds, down from 1 minute, 18 seconds. A further benchmark, NeroScore, which measures AI-powered photograph tagging, produced a rating of two,584 earlier than the overclock and three,284 after. In the event you get into guide tweaking on a top-tier motherboard with DDR5 RAM, there’s positive to be extra headroom to use.

There is not a lot to be mentioned about Intel’s UHD 770 built-in GPU – efficiency positive factors over the earlier era are marginal. Even in case you will not get a lot use out of it, an built-in GPU is sweet to have for troubleshooting and assembling. It might even be a lifesaver, contemplating the consumer-unfriendly GPU market we’re coping with proper now. For that cause, I might at all times desire a CPU with an iGPU over an -F variant – until there’s an enormous value distinction.

Verdict

When the 11th Gen ‘Rocket Lake’ Core CPU household was launched in March this yr, I referred to as it a placeholder, since we already had a good suggestion of what Alder Lake was shaping as much as be and when it might launch. Intel strongly refuted that characterisation, and the corporate’s logic was that these have been the perfect CPUs for sure workloads obtainable on the time – which, to be honest, was true. Finally, I suggested folks to carry off on a purchase order if they might, since lots was about to vary.

You probably have waited this lengthy, you will be very glad. The 12th Gen is a substantial enchancment in practically all facets of efficiency. That is the launch that may persuade many individuals to improve from their present setups. It is a roaring success for Intel after years of lacklustre updates, first due to an absence of competitors and later due to its personal inside issues. The arrival of DDR5, PCIe 5.0, Home windows 11, and heterogenous-core CPUs have injected new life into the PC market.

So far as content material creation and multitasking go, you’ll be able to’t go flawed with the brand new Alder Lake era. The most effective information for patrons is that these unlocked 12th Gen Core CPUs aren’t priced out of attain – efficiency at mainstream costs in lots of circumstances exceeds that of the 18-core Core i9-10980XE, which was at one level thought of a discount at round Rs. 70,000, and that too was half the worth of its predecessor. The Core i9-12900K places Intel’s X-series out of fee, and it is no shock {that a} refresh hasn’t occurred for the HEDT phase this yr. If you wish to do higher, you will wish to have a look at one thing just like the Ryzen Threadripper collection for large brute-force all-core efficiency – however that is a complete completely different market phase and pricing displays that.

Intel hasn’t fairly pulled off a decisive victory over AMD’s Ryzen 5000 collection although – there are workloads that may nonetheless favour the Zen structure with a number of cores, and we’ll have a brand new era from the inexperienced staff quickly sufficient. Additionally remember that you will want an costly Z690 motherboard and DDR5 RAM to get essentially the most out of the unlocked fanatic SKUs launched up to now – whenever you add up all these costs, AMD might simply come out forward for many individuals.
